Inlays & onlays
Inlays and onlays are custom restorations used when a tooth needs more reinforcement than a filling can reliably provide, but still has enough healthy structure to avoid a full crown. They fit precisely into or over the affected area, restoring strength while preserving natural tooth tissue.
These restorations are designed using detailed digital scans, allowing us to create a piece that blends seamlessly and supports comfortable chewing. They offer excellent durability and are often recommended when we want to balance strength with a conservative approach.
What to expect
- The tooth is prepared gently
- A digital scan is taken to design your inlay or onlay
- A temporary piece protects the area during fabrication
- At your second visit, the final restoration is bonded securely and adjusted so your bite feels natural
Why they’re beneficial
Inlays and onlays help:
- Reinforce weakened tooth structure
- Protect remaining healthy enamel
- Offer long-term stability without the need for a full-coverage crown
